You should do a little reading under the heading that you posted , a lot of info here and links to all kinds , there is basicly 2 ways to go , 1st [ the only one I recomend ] is called transesterfication , removes the gliserin [ soap/wax ] ,
The 2nd is several ways of trying to get gliserin to burn through heating , mixing with a compination of other fuels or chem.
Yes it is got lots of lubricity , but it will clean out the entire fuel system , tank to exhaust , when I 1st used , I started with 10 % of a comecailly processed bio , after 1 wk [ maybe 250-300 miles ] the fuel filter [ that was about due ] pluged up from the cleaning effect .
Then I switched to 1/3 bio 2/3 dyno , this is becouse of looking into to this a lot and found the best power/millage for my truck , a little more of both , and the smell was a lot better on my eyes & nose .
